| CAMMEL, C.R. (CROWLEY, ALEISTER) Aleister Crowley: The Black Magician London, New English Library. 1969, First Thus. (ISBN: 0450003736) Paperback, 16mo - over 5¾" - 6¾" tall. Biography by a close friend of Aleister Crowley and father of Performance director Donald Cammell. Aleister Crowley (1875-1947) has been seen variously as a man of notorious sexual habits, a satanic occultist, and latterly an icon of the 1960s love generation. But Crowley was neither a mere sexual predator nor a vulgar black magician. He was the synthesizer of what he termed Magick, a system of occult philosophy and technique outlined in such classic texts as The Book Of The Law and Magick In Theory And Practice. Crowley's vision combined clarity, intellectual power and a strange, sometimes frightening, beauty. Fine.
